I added the support for running multiple clients for multiprocessor machines. Added the ability to pass options to the Folding clients. This can be done through the use of the foldingathome conf.d file. Added a new init.d script for accomadate this, as well has a new initfolding for easy configuring of the client.cfg file in every directory.
